Misia at Megaron, Athens Concert Hall

Misia at Megaron, Athens Concert Hall
Misia, one of the best-known performers of fado contemporary Portuguese music, will be appearing at the "Megaron" Athens Concert Hall for a night of poetic melancholy and absolute theatricality on 8 March in Athens, Greece. Misia will be presenting her new show "Ruas (Roads)," based on her new CD, singing with nostalgia and taking us to the dream of her homeland, Lisbon. These are the roads of life, roads of the heart, the roads of saudade; of love and absence. The roads of all roads; those of the unpredictable fado. We all follow roads until we reach the final turn. In all of the places we pass through, the people we meet and later part from, all these Roads of Cities throughout the world where the sensitive and tireless people walk, we are "trying to live our lives and spread jam on our hearts."

The show will include "Lisboarium," a dream-like and imaginary journey through the roads of Lisbon, its neighbourhoods and its music, not only fado but also marchas de Lisboa and Morna.

It will also feature "Tourists," which, as Misia explains, is for artists from various roads of the world, from other cultures, but those who have fado in their soul. Some of them will surely have sung fado if they were born in Portugal.
